February 14, 201213 yr Some models came stock with a double din. If yours is not, it can be as simple as going to the junk yard and finding a double din bezel. The bezel is the only difference the inside of the dash is the same.
February 14, 201213 yr noob question but how do i tell if it has the double din bezel?? The opening for the radio is like twice the size lol. The only thing you have to mod is there is a little plastic piece that runs across the top of where the radio mounts that you have to cut out in order for a double din to fit.
